Analysis

In 2024, mortality rate age 10-19 - un igme estimates in United States stood at 3.45.

That represents a change of down 5.6% on the previous year and up 13.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, mortality rate age 10-19 - un igme estimates in United States peaked at 5.66 in 1990 and was at its lowest, 3.02, in 2013.

That places United States 130th out of 200 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 35 years of available data.

Mortality rate age 10-19 - UN IGME estimates in United States, year by year

Annual values for Mortality rate age 10-19 - UN IGME estimates (projection) in United States, 1990 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1990 5.66
1991 5.61 -0.8%
1992 5.58 -0.6%
1993 5.55 -0.4%
1994 5.49 -1.2%
1995 5.34 -2.8%
1996 5.12 -4.1%
1997 4.89 -4.4%
1998 4.69 -4.1%
1999 4.53 -3.4%
2000 4.42 -2.4%
2001 4.35 -1.6%
2002 4.3 -1.2%
2003 4.25 -1.2%
2004 4.19 -1.3%
2005 4.12 -1.6%
2006 4.02 -2.4%
2007 3.86 -4.0%
2008 3.65 -5.6%
2009 3.42 -6.1%
2010 3.24 -5.3%
2011 3.12 -3.9%
2012 3.04 -2.3%
2013 3.02 -0.6%
2014 3.05 +0.8%
2015 3.11 +1.9%
2016 3.18 +2.5%
2017 3.26 +2.3%
2018 3.33 +2.2%
2019 3.43 +3.1%
2020 3.6 +4.8%
2021 3.77 +4.6%
2022 3.8 +1.0%
2023 3.66 -3.7%
2024 3.45 -5.6%
